MACPA Collaborates with IASeminars to offer IFRS Training


Baltimore, MD (PRWEB) June 18, 2012

Following recent statements from the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C), some 18,000 U.S. public companies may need to switch from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) to IFRS when preparing future financial statements, or else they could see important changes being made to GAAP as a result of international accounting harmonization. This transition would affect up to a million preparers and users of US financial statements. Many international companies with a presence in the United States already use IFRS, which is required or permitted in more than 120 other countries around the world.

IASeminars offers over 100 different international accounting topics in some 30 cities around the world, including Abu Dhabi, Baltimore, Chicago, Johannesburg, London, New York, Sao Paulo, Toronto and Zurich, among others. By collaborating with IASeminars, the MACPA will offer its members and other key stakeholders additional professional development opportunities on a topic that is expected to attract considerable future interest.

About IASeminars:

IASeminars is an independent global financial training company based in London, England and Washington DC, USA. Originally founded in the UK in 2002 to provide training solutions to EU companies planning for their 2005 transition to IFRS, IASeminars has since expanded to become a successful worldwide operation. In the last 10 years, more than 13,000 participants from over 130 different countries have attended an IASeminars event. IASeminars has established a strong reputation around the world by offering a particularly comprehensive and technical range of international accounting courses.
